University of Ghana College of Health Science Courses and Requirements

COLLEGE OF HEALTH SCIENCES – WASSCE/SSSCE Applicants

Short-listed applicants into programmes at the College of Health Sciences must pass an entrance examination and/or interview.

School of Medicine & Dentistry

  1.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ery
  2. Bachelor of Dental Surgery
  • Core:  Credit passes in English, Core Mathematics, Integrated Science & Social Studies
  • Electives: Credit passes in Chemistry and any Two (2) two from Physics, Biology and Elective Mathematics

 

School of Pharmacy

Doctor of Pharmacy

  • Core:  Credit passes in English, Core Mathematics, Integrated Science & Social Studies
  • Electives:  Credit passes in Three (3) Electives comprising Chemistry, Biology and either Physics or Elective Mathematics

School of Biological & Allied Health Sciences

  1. Bachelor of Science in Dietetics
  2. Bachelor of Science in Medical Laboratory
  3. Bachelor of Science in Occupational Therapy
  4. Bachelor of Science in Physiotherapy
  5. Bachelor of Science in Radiography
  • Core:  Credit passes in English, Core Mathematics, Integrated Science & Social Studies
  • Electives:  Credit passes in Three (3) Electives comprising Chemistry, Biology and either Physics or Elective Mathematics

 

School of Nursing & Midwifery

Bachelor of Science in Nursing

  • Core:  Credit passes in English, Core Mathematics, Integrated Science & Social Studies
  • Electives Credit passes in Three (3) Electives from any of the combinations below:
    • Chemistry, Physics, Biology or Elective Mathematics
    • General Agriculture, Physics & Chemistry
    • Three General Arts Electives
    • Two General Arts Electives plus Food & Nutrition
    • Any three of the following Electives: Economics, Management in Living, Food & Nutrition, Chemistry, General Knowledge in Art and French.
